Hello. So I've made the mistake of sending a transaction with too low of a fee. How can I dig myself out of this? Needless to say I am inexperienced. If I just have to wait, is there a rough estimate?

Client: MultiBit HD 0.5.1

Sequence of events:
1. Sent initial 0.0116 with low fee. Unsure exact time frame, 6~ days ago. Yet to be processed. https://blockchain.info/tx/4a030ba9f47f520efdd27a52ccd5697c4ee175104076442c8e648050e1944820
2. Tried to send a additional 0.0109 with a higher fee. Received an error related to part of the balance was sending. 3~ days ago. https://blockchain.info/tx/57b6761f77ad1ae7578f5a003c453f566c585eb20ea5915880288295b0602dfd
3. Rebuilt multibit wallet, balance now shows as 0.00 and a unconfirmed balance. 2~ days ago.

If you still have some output from these transaction in your wallet then try sending it with high fees like 500 satoshi per byte.Miners will confirm all your transaction if you spend output from these transaction with high fees.
